All Holiday Inn in or near Indian Rocks Beach

Holiday Inn Hotel & Suites Clearwater Beach S Harbourside in Indian Rocks Beach
+1-888-389-4121
401 2nd St., Indian Rocks Beach, FL 33785 +1-888-389-4121 ~0.54 miles north of Indian Rocks Beach center
  • Affordable Beach property
  • Fitness center on property
From$129
Average 3.0 /5 Guest Reviews Call BookMore Details
Holiday Inn Express & Suites Largo - Largo
+1-888-675-2083
210 Seminole Blvd., Largo, FL 33770 +1-888-675-2083 ~4.75 miles northeast of Indian Rocks Beach center
  • Affordable Downtown property
  • 5 floors in property
From$119
Average 3.0 /5 Guest Reviews Call BookMore Details
Holiday Inn Express & Suites St. Petersburg Madeira Beach : 4816 100th Way North
+1-800-716-8490
4816 100th Way North, St. Petersburg, FL 33708 +1-800-716-8490 ~6.05 miles southeast of Indian Rocks Beach center
  • Mid-scale Suburban hotel
  • Hotel has 121 rooms
From$98
Very Good 4.0 /5 Read Reviews Call BookMore Details
Holiday Inn & Suites Clearwater Beach - Clearwater Beach
+1-800-805-5223
521 South Gulfview Blvd., Clearwater Beach, FL 33767 +1-800-805-5223 ~6.56 miles north of Indian Rocks Beach center
  • Mid-scale Resort property
  • 209 rooms in property
From$107
Very Good 4.0 /5 Reviews Call BookMore Details
Holiday Inn Express Clearwater East Icot Center
+1-888-965-1860
13625 Icot Blvd., Clearwater, FL 33760 +1-888-965-1860 ~8.48 miles east of Indian Rocks Beach center
  • Mid-scale Airport hotel
  • Gym is available on property
From$109
Average 3.0 /5 Recent Reviews Call BookMore Details
Holiday Inn Express & Suites Clearwater / Us 19 N : 2580 Gulf To Bay Blvd.
+1-888-788-5576
2580 Gulf To Bay Blvd., Clearwater, FL 33765 +1-888-788-5576 ~9.47 miles northeast of Indian Rocks Beach center
  • Three Star Downtown property
  • Comp. Breakfast
From$99
Average 3.5 /5 Latest Reviews Call BookMore Details
Holiday Inn Express Hotel & Suites Clearwater North Dunedin An I : 975 Broadway St.
+1-888-897-9207
975 Broadway St., Dunedin, FL 34698 +1-888-897-9207 ~10.41 miles north of Indian Rocks Beach center
  • Midscale Downtown property
  • 3 floors in hotel
From$115
Very Good 4.0 /5 Reviews Call BookMore Details
Holiday Inn St. Petersburg N Clearwater : 3535 Ulmerton Rd.
+1-888-311-4278
3535 Ulmerton Rd., Clearwater, FL 33762 +1-888-311-4278 ~10.41 miles east of Indian Rocks Beach center
  • Three Star Airport property
  • 5 meeting rooms in property
From$80
Very Good 4.5 /5 Guest Reviews Call BookMore Details
Holiday Inn Express & Suites St. Petersburg North (I 275) An Ihg : 2171 54th Ave. North
+1-888-469-4795
2171 54th Ave. North, St Petersburg, FL 33714 +1-888-469-4795 ~12.11 miles east of Indian Rocks Beach center
  • Midscale Highway property
  • 76 rooms in property
From$90
Very Good 4.0 /5 Read Reviews Call BookMore Details
Holiday Inn St. Petersburg West
+1-888-734-9421
1200 34th St. North, St. Petersburg, FL 33713 +1-888-734-9421 ~12.22 miles southeast of Indian Rocks Beach center
  • Mid-scale Highway property
  • Hotel has 4 suites
From$80
Average 3.0 /5 Hotel Reviews Call BookMore Details
Holiday Inn Express Hotel & Suites Tampa Northwest - Oldsmar, an : 3990 Tampa Rd.
+1-888-841-5292
3990 Tampa Rd., Oldsmar, FL 34677 +1-888-841-5292 ~16.21 miles northeast of Indian Rocks Beach center
  • 3-star Suburban hotel
  • Free breakfast available
From$59
Very Good 4.0 /5 Recent Reviews Call BookMore Details
Holiday Inn Express Hotel & Suites Tampa-Rocky Point Island, an I : 3025 North Rocky Point Dr. East
+1-888-455-5160
3025 North Rocky Point Dr. East, Tampa, FL 33607 +1-888-455-5160 ~18.73 miles east of Indian Rocks Beach center
  • 3 star Airport hotel
  • 88 rooms in hotel
From$97
Average 3.0 /5 Latest Reviews Call BookMore Details
Holiday Inn Tampa Westshore Airport Area An Ihg Hotel
+1-888-965-8297
700 North Westshore Blvd., Tampa, FL 33609 +1-888-965-8297 ~20.65 miles east of Indian Rocks Beach center
  • 3 star Airport hotel
  • 10 meeting rooms in property
From$75
Very Good 4.0 /5 Review Score Call BookMore Details
Holiday Inn Express Hotel & Suites Tampa-Anderson Rd/Veteran, an : 9402 Corporate Lake Dr.
+1-888-906-6358
9402 Corporate Lake Dr., Tampa, FL 33634 +1-888-906-6358 ~21.94 miles northeast of Indian Rocks Beach center
  • 2 star Airport hotel
  • Check in: 3:00 pm
From$60
Very Good 4.0 /5 Hotel Reviews Call BookMore Details
Holiday Inn Express & Suites Tampa Stadium Airport Area An Ihg
+1-888-749-6785
2055 North Dale Mabry Highway, Tampa, FL 33607 +1-888-749-6785 ~21.97 miles east of Indian Rocks Beach center
  • 2 star Airport hotel
  • Free breakfast
From$60
Average 3.0 /5 Latest Reviews Call BookMore Details
Holiday Inn Express & Suites Trinity - Trinity
+1-888-878-9982
2125 Corporate Center Dr., Trinity, FL 34655 +1-888-878-9982 ~25.63 miles northeast of Indian Rocks Beach center
  • 3 star Suburban property
  • Access to gym on-site
From$85
Very Good 4.4 /5 Hotel Reviews Call BookMore Details
Holiday Inn Express & Suites Tampa USF Busch Gardens, an IHG Hote : 2807 East Busch Blvd.
+1-888-389-4485
2807 East Busch Blvd., Tampa, FL 33612 +1-888-389-4485 ~28.02 miles east of Indian Rocks Beach center
  • 3-star Suburban hotel
  • Check in time: 3:00 PM
From$73
Average 3.0 /5 Reviews Call BookMore Details
Holiday Inn Express & Suites in Tampa
+1-888-389-4121
2520 North 50th St., Tampa, FL 33619 +1-888-389-4121 ~28.07 miles east of Indian Rocks Beach center
  • Low-priced Convention Center property
  • Hotel has 100 rooms
From$99
Average 3.0 /5 Reviews Call BookMore Details
Holiday Inn Tampa North An Ihg Hotel
+1-888-675-2083
3751 East Fowler Ave., Tampa, FL 33612 +1-888-675-2083 ~29.21 miles east of Indian Rocks Beach center
  • Mid-scale Suburban property
  • Hotel has an eco-friendly policy See policy
From$100
Average 3.0 /5 Hotel Reviews Call BookMore Details
Holiday Inn Exp Ruskin
+1-800-716-8490
226 Teco Rd., Ruskin, FL 33701 +1-800-716-8490 ~30.54 miles east of Indian Rocks Beach center
  • Affordable Suburban hotel
  • Check in time: 15:00
From$60
Average 3.0 /5 Hotel Reviews Call BookMore Details
Holiday Inn Express & Suites Tampa Fairgrounds
+1-800-805-5223
8610 Elm Fair Blvd., Tampa, FL 33610 +1-800-805-5223 ~31.17 miles east of Indian Rocks Beach center
  • Three Star Rural hotel
  • Hotel has 4 floors
From$80
Very Good 4.0 /5 Guest Reviews Call BookMore Details
Holiday Inn Express Hotel & Suites Port Richey, an IHG Hotel in Port Richey
+1-888-965-1860
10619 Us Highway 19, Port Richey, FL 34668 +1-888-965-1860 ~31.67 miles north of Indian Rocks Beach center
  • Three Star Highway property
  • Gym is available on property
From$95
Very Good 4.0 /5 Guest Reviews Call BookMore Details
Holiday Inn Express Tampa N I-75 - University Area, an IHG Hotel : 13294 Telecom Dr.
+1-888-788-5576
13294 Telecom Dr., Tampa, FL 33637 +1-888-788-5576 ~31.99 miles east of Indian Rocks Beach center
  • 3-star Suburban hotel
  • 92 sleeping rooms in hotel
From$79
Very Good 4.0 /5 Hotel Reviews Call BookMore Details
Holiday Inn Express & Suites Bradenton West An Ihg Hotel - Bradenton
+1-888-897-9207
4450 47th St. West, Bradenton, FL 34210 +1-888-897-9207 ~32.23 miles southeast of Indian Rocks Beach center
  • 3-star Highway hotel
  • 129 rooms in hotel
From$87
Very Good 4.0 /5 Read Reviews Call BookMore Details
Holiday Inn Express Tampa Brandon An Ihg Hotel : 510 Grand Regency Blvd.
+1-888-311-4278
510 Grand Regency Blvd., Brandon, FL 33510 +1-888-311-4278 ~32.43 miles east of Indian Rocks Beach center
  • Mid-scale Suburban property
  • Comp. Breakfast
From$82
Very Good 4.5 /5 Recent Reviews Call BookMore Details
Holiday Inn Express Hotel & Suites New Tampa
+1-888-469-4795
8310 Galbraith Rd., Tampa, FL 33647 +1-888-469-4795 ~34.41 miles northeast of Indian Rocks Beach center
  • Three Star Suburban property
  • 27 suites in hotel
From$68
Very Good 4.0 /5 Read Reviews Call BookMore Details
Holiday Inn Express & Suites Tampa North Wesley Chapel An Ihg in Wesley Chapel
+1-888-734-9421
2775 Cypress Ridge Blvd., Wesley Chapel, FL 33544 +1-888-734-9421 ~36.17 miles northeast of Indian Rocks Beach center
  • Three Star Suburban property
  • Free breakfast
From$87
Very Good 4.0 /5 Latest Reviews Call BookMore Details
Holiday Inn Express & Suites Bradenton East-Lakewood Ranch, an IH
+1-888-841-5292
5464 Lena Rd., Bradenton, FL 34211 +1-888-841-5292 ~38.73 miles southeast of Indian Rocks Beach center
  • Three Star Highway hotel
  • Check in time: 3:00 PM
From$99
Very Good 4.0 /5 Latest Reviews Call BookMore Details
Holiday Inn Express Hotel & Suites Spring Hill, an IHG Hotel
+1-888-455-5160
3528 Commercial Way, Spring Hill, FL 34606 +1-888-455-5160 ~44.58 miles north of Indian Rocks Beach center
  • Affordable Rural hotel
  • Fitness + Health Center
From$79
Very Good 4.0 /5 Hotel Reviews Call BookMore Details
Back to Top